Shimmin started his career spending six years at Highbury playing for the various youth teams at Arsenal under Arsène Wenger.
[2] Shimmin made his début against Coventry City in a 3–0 defeat, however a serious nose injury prevented him from playing many games for QPR.
[11] Shimmin was named Irn-Bru Phenomenal Young Player of the Month for October 2008, after helping Morton to rally after a poor start to the season.
[12] Shimmin spent nine months out 'injured', from March 2009, making a return on the bench for the Scottish Cup game at Dumbarton on 5 December.
[16] Shimmin made four appearances for the England under-16 side in 2003, whilst playing in the David Carins Memorial Trophy in County Antrim, Northern Ireland.
